商城网站建设需要具备哪些技能

商城网站建设需要具备哪些技能

admin 2025-11-24 信息公开 6 次浏览 0个评论

在数字化时代,商城网站成为了商业活动的重要载体,越来越多的企业选择通过建立商城网站来进行产品销售。然而,要构建一个高效且用户友好的商城网站,开发人员需要具备多方面的技能。本文将深入探讨商城网站建设所需的核心技能,从前端开发、后端开发、数据库管理、以及用户体验设计等方面进行详细分析,以帮助读者理解这些技能的具体要求与应用。

商城网站建设需要具备哪些技能
(图片来源网络,侵删)

一、前端开发:用户界面的构建

前端开发是商城网站建设中的第一道屏障,它决定了用户的第一印象和互动体验。前端开发主要涉及HTML、CSS和JavaScript的使用。HTML负责构建网页的基本结构,而CSS则决定了网页的样式和布局。JavaScript则为网页添加了互动性和动态效果,如弹出窗口、滚动特效等。

为了确保商城网站的良好用户体验,前端开发还需要注重响应式设计。这意味着无论用户使用的是手机、平板还是电脑,网页都能自适应不同的屏幕尺寸,从而提供一致的使用体验。利用前端框架如Bootstrap、Vue.js和React.js可以大大提高开发效率并确保代码的可维护性。

除了基础的前端技能,开发者还需关注网页性能优化。加载速度过慢的网站会导致用户流失,影响商城的销量。通过图像压缩、懒加载、代码拆分等优化手段,可以大幅提升网站的访问速度,进而提升用户的使用满意度。

二、后端开发:服务器和数据库的支撑

后端开发是商城网站的核心,涉及服务器、数据库和应用程序的逻辑处理。商城网站需要处理大量的用户请求、订单信息、支付数据等,这要求后端开发能够高效地设计和实现相应的功能。后端开发语言如PHP、Python、Java和Node.js常常被用于实现这些功能。

一个商城网站通常需要强大的数据库支持。MySQL、MongoDB、PostgreSQL等数据库管理系统是常见的选择,能够存储用户信息、商品数据和交易记录等。在设计数据库时,开发者需要考虑数据的规范化、查询效率和扩展性,以确保系统能够处理大量并发请求。

安全性也是后端开发不可忽视的部分。商城网站涉及敏感的用户信息和支付数据,因此必须采取有效的安全措施,如数据加密、身份验证和授权机制、SQL注入防护等,防止黑客攻击和数据泄露。

三、数据库管理:数据的存储与优化

数据库管理是商城网站建设中不可或缺的一部分,它直接影响到系统的稳定性和性能。在商城网站中,数据库需要存储商品信息、库存数据、用户账号信息、订单信息等多个方面的数据,这要求数据库设计必须规范且高效。

数据库优化是确保商城网站高效运行的关键。开发者需要根据业务需求对数据库进行性能优化,包括索引优化、查询优化和缓存策略等。合理的索引可以显著提高查询效率,缓存技术如Redis、Memcached可以减少对数据库的直接访问,提升系统的响应速度。

此外,数据备份和恢复机制也是数据库管理的重要方面。为了防止数据丢失或损坏,开发者需要定期备份数据库,并制定有效的恢复方案,确保商城网站在发生故障时能够快速恢复正常运行。

四、用户体验设计:优化用户互动与满意度

用户体验(UX)设计是商城网站建设中非常重要的一环。一个优秀的商城网站不仅要具备强大的功能,还要能够提供流畅且愉悦的用户体验。UX设计师需要从用户需求出发,设计简洁、直观且易用的界面。

首先,用户体验设计需要关注网站的导航结构。商城网站通常拥有大量的商品和信息,如何将这些信息呈现给用户是设计的重点。通过合理的分类、搜索功能和过滤功能,用户能够快速找到自己想要的商品,提高购买转化率。

其次,支付流程的设计也直接影响用户的购买决策。设计简洁且高效的支付流程,能够减少用户在支付环节的疑虑和操作难度,从而提升转化率。此外,网站的视觉设计、色彩搭配、字体选择等也会影响用户的整体感受,良好的视觉设计能够提高用户的满意度和忠诚度。

五、总结:

商城网站建设是一个复杂且多元化的过程,需要开发人员在前端、后端、数据库管理和用户体验设计等多个方面具备扎实的技能。通过合理的技术架构、性能优化和用户友好的设计,才能构建出一个高效、稳定且易用的商城网站,满足用户的需求并提升业务的竞争力。未来,随着技术的不断发展,商城网站的功能和用户体验将更加丰富,开发者需要不断学习和适应新的技术趋势。

本文由发布,如无特别说明文章均为原创,请勿采集、转载、复制。

转载请注明来自河北尚泉拍卖有限公司,本文标题:《商城网站建设需要具备哪些技能》

每一天,每一秒,你所做的决定都会改变你的人生!

发表评论

快捷回复:

评论列表 (暂无评论,6人围观)参与讨论

还没有评论,来说两句吧...